Party Horror: Woman’s Narrow Escape After Stabbing at Nairobi Politician’s Apartment
Investigators at Kilimani Police Station in Nairobi are probing an incident where a woman was stabbed several times in a short-stay rental apartment within Nairobi and survived with stab wounds.
Patricia Muthoni Karanja is the latest victim of violence reported in a short-stay rental apartment in the country.
Her story is a testimony of how she survived an attack that has left her nursing serious stab wound injuries.
“They kept attacking me, I was screaming because I realized I had to save myself, record what was happening, or no one would ever know what happenedโฆ” recounts Patricia Muthoni.
The young woman was invited to a meeting with a sitting legislator which turned into a party at a club within Kilimani. As the party went on, the victim, two other women, and the politician agreed to spend the night at a short-stay rental within Kilimani.
The victim says that while at the rental, the two other women, well-known to the politician, turned their rage on her. She says one of the women attacked her, stabbing her several times.
“โฆthey were picking forks, knives from the kitchen and attacking meโฆas I tried to defend myself, Sally took a knife and stabbed me on this side,” adds Patricia.
After the assault, she was locked in the room and left alone. She was rescued by security guards who heard her cry.
“I was screaming, banging the door, I was screaming, and the guards came to the house. The guard then called the police. While at the station, I could not take my statement, I was unconsciousโฆ” she says

Confirming the incident, Kilimani Police Commander Kobia Bariu said Patricia suffered serious stab wounds to her lower abdomen and other bodily injuries.
โThe stab wound was so deep, it was on the lower abdomenโฆ,” said the police commander.
Police say Patricia suffered serious stab wounds to her lower abdomen and other bodily injuries.
After the rescue, she was admitted to a nearby facility for medical attention.
Police have since arrested the suspect.
“Investigations are ongoing, and with time, we will get to know what transpiredโฆ” added the police commander.
“They were on a drinking spree. During this time, it’s when the fighting started. We are finding out more detailsโฆ”
Even though she is concerned about the progress of investigations, investigators say they are monitoring the case and court process.
